Local residents and business people will have a second chance to register feedback for a proposed $16 million social housing development in Warragul.
The online information session will be held today at 7pm. It follows last week's drop-in session held at the West Gippsland Arts Centre.
The four-storey development, featuring 51 units, is proposed for 8-18 Mason St.
Housing Choices Australia, who secured funding for the development under the state government's Big Housing Build, did not say how many people attended the drop-in session on Thursday nor feedback received.
The proposal is exempt from requiring a Baw Baw Shire Council planning permit. The land, neighbouring the Commercial Hotel and old Bonlac milk factory site, is currently zoned commercial.
Community feedback is open until Wednesday, May 31 at 5pm.
